About The Position

SA Recycling is one of the largest scrap metal recyclers in the United States and is experiencing significant growth. We are looking for a General Laborer to join our expanding operations. The laborer will work on various tasks as assigned, including general housekeeping, inspecting metal processing, upgrading materials, and assisting technical workers. This role offers the opportunity to learn new skills, progress to more technical tasks, and become more independent.

Responsibilities

  • Unloading pallets, boxes, and bundles
  • Material handling / sorting – pushing, pulling, picking, lifting, carrying, and filling up hoppers, boxes, and conveyor belts
  • Unpacking boxes using box cutters, separating plastics, zip ties, blister packs, and other packaging materials
  • Disassembling small equipment, cutting wires, torqueing pipefittings, removing bolts, automobile parts, and appliance parts
  • Work with recycling equipment for processing metal product e.g. metal shears, band saw and wire strippers
  • Direct traffic of yard vehicles traveling through yard
  • Light facility maintenance – painting, scraping, moving furniture and equipment
  • Maintenance – selecting and using tools properly, pulling and installing parts for machinery, working with other employees to assist machinery repair
  • Housekeeping – sweeping, cleaning, shoveling, and debris collection
  • Moderate and Periodic landscaping work
  • Clean up work area at the end of shift
  • Keep work areas neat and orderly
  • Organizing materials to have more effective use of space
  • Dispose of various waste materials in the appropriate manner
  • Inspection
  • Effective housekeeping in workplace area is an ongoing operation for safety and better hygienic conditions for all team members.
